Congresswoman Mary Gay Scanlon, representing Pennsylvania’s 5th district, has taken to social media to share her views on recent developments affecting federal workers and privacy concerns. The tweets reflect her active role in addressing issues she perceives as significant for her constituents and the broader public.

On February 6, 2025, Scanlon expressed support for federal workers with a brief message stating "A win for federal workers!"

Later that day, she addressed privacy concerns involving Elon Musk and the Treasury payment system. She tweeted: "House Republicans let Elon Musk invade your privacy by accessing personal data in the highly confidential Treasury payment system. House Democrats will not stand for it. We're introducing the Taxpayer Data Protection Act today to fight back."

On February 7, 2025, Congresswoman Scanlon commented on accountability issues, tweeting: "He's getting rid of everyone whose job is to hold him accountable."
